The hexadecimal color code #EDDB50 corresponds to the code RGB( 237, 219, 80 ). It's a shade of Yellow. This color is a combination of red (at 0,93 level), green (at 0,86 level) and blue (at 0,31 level). Its brightness is 62% and its saturation is 81%. It is composed of red at 44%, green at 40% and blue at 14%.
